Output 6ea93645cb2bafb3d54f5359072e9c4ef68118c67526d7513e5fc67666c67139:620

value
534000
script pubkey
OP_0 OP_PUSHBYTES_20 d6627c83e8c580928081fd2269aa01238ac33c36
address
bc1q6e38eqlgckqf9qypl53xn2spyw9vx0pkuvrzhw
transaction
6ea93645cb2bafb3d54f5359072e9c4ef68118c67526d7513e5fc67666c67139
spent
true